Eric Biggers
6cb5a36f4c init: fix mkdir to reliably detect top-level /data directories
To determine the default encryption action, the mkdir command checks
whether the given path is a top-level directory of /data.  However, it
assumed a path without any duplicate slashes or trailing slash(es).

While everyone *should* be providing paths without unnecessary slashes,
it is not guaranteed, as paths with unnecessary slashes still work
correctly for all other parts of the mkdir command, including the
SELinux label lookup and the actual directory creation.  In particular,
the /data/fonts directory is being created using 'mkdir /data/fonts/'.

The effect is that the mkdir command thinks that /data/fonts/ is *not* a
top-level directory of /data, so it defaults to no encryption action.
Fortunately, the full command happens to use "encryption=Require", so we
dodged a bullet there, though the warning "Inferred action different
from explicit one" is still triggered.

There are a few approaches we could take here, including even just
fixing the /data/fonts/ command specifically, but I think the best
solution is to have mkdir clean its path at the very beginning.  This
retains the Linux path semantics that people expect, while avoiding
surprises in path processing afterwards.  This CL implements that.

Note, this CL intentionally changes the behavior of, and thus would
break, any existing cases where mkdir is used to create a top-level
/data directory using a path with unnecessary slashes and without using
an explicit encryption action.  There are no known cases where this
already occurs, however.  No cases exist in platform code, and vendor
init scripts shouldn't be creating top-level /data directories anyway.

Jooyung Han
badb7de1a2 APEX configs support 'on' as well
APEX configs have supported only 'service' definitions. For those
services relying on 'on' trigger actions, we had to have separate config
files installed in read-only partitions (e.g. /system/etc/init).

This was suboptimal because even though APEXes are updatable, read-only
partitions are not.

Now, 'on' is supported in APEX configs. Putting 'on' trigger actions
near to service definitions makes APEX more self-contained.

'on' trigger actions loaded from APEX configs are not sticky. So, events
happens before loading APEX configs can't trigger actions. For example,
'post-fs-data' is where APEX configs are loaded for now, so 'on
post-fs-data' in APEX configs can't be triggerd.

Eric Biggers
ef9275223c Move creation of /data/user/0 and /data/media/obb to vold
To prevent bugs, directory creation and encryption should happen
together.  /data/user/0 (and its "alias" /data/data) is a per-user
encrypted directory; such directories can only be encrypted by vold.
Therefore, move its creation to vold as well.

Besides closing the uncomfortably-large gap between the creation and
encryption of /data/user/0, this allows removing init's write access to
/data/user and similar directories (SELinux type system_userdir_file) to
prevent any such issues from being reintroduced in the future.

To also allow removing init's write access to /data/media (SELinux type
media_userdir_file), which also contains per-user encrypted directories,
also move the creation and encryption of /data/media/obb to vold.

Suren Baghdasaryan
746ede9629 init: try converting writepid used with cgroups into task_profiles command
writepid usage to add a task to a cgroup was deprecated in favor of the
task_profile command. The reason is that writepid hardcodes cgroup path
and makes it hard to change it in the future, whereas task profiles
configure cgroup paths in one centralized place and are easy to change.
Log a warning when writepid is used with cgroups and try converting it
into a task_profiles command for well-known cgroups. If conversion is
not possible the writepid operation will still be attempted to avoid
breaking existing use cases and an error will be logged.

Suren Baghdasaryan
1bd1746447 init: Treat failure to create a process group as fatal
During process startup, system creates a process group and places the
new process in it. If process group creation fails for some reason, the
new child process will stay in its parent's group. This poses danger
when the child is being frozen because the whole group is affected and
its parent is being frozen as well.
Fix this by treating group creation failure as a fatal error which would
prevent the app from starting.
